Thailand mulls external reserves managers

Tarisa Watanagase, the governor of the Bank of Thailand, says the central bank may outsource the management of part of its $73 billion reserve holdings to maximise investment returns.

Tarisa says BOT aiming to convert to bank deposits

Bank of Thailand governor Tarisa Watanagase said Tuesday 20 February the central bank will not need to issue the same number of bonds as it did in the past once it is authorised by a new law that will allow it to take deposits from commercial banks.

Tarisa says BoT created 'uncertainty'

The Bank of Thailand deliberately created "uncertainty" in the foreign exchange market to drive out speculators from Japan and the U.S. when it imposed curbs on investment, governor Tarisa Watanagase told Bloomberg in an interview Monday 15 January.
